I have a 1980 monte carlo with a 1986 monte carlo ss rearend in it and today I went to grease the rear u joint and noticed that the drive shaft moves around in the u joint straps all the 4 bolts are tight do I need smaller u joint straps if so what kinds and part number?Thanks
 
To be honest, if the correct one was installed there shouldn't be a need for bigger caps or the need to get different retaining straps. There are many combinations of the cap sizes but there is no guarantee that the cap I.D. with needle bearings in place will be the same size even knowing what part number was installed & just grabbing one with the needed O.D. off the shelf. In this case a new U joint meeting the needed specs would be suggested.
 
I would start by removing the straps and verifying the current driveshaft u-joint fits snug in the rear end yoke.
